North Dakota Code § 54-12-08.1

Contingent fee arrangements

The attorney general may not appoint or allow to be employed a special assistant attorney 
general in a civil case in which the amount in controversy exceeds one million dollars and the 
special assistant attorney general is compensated by a contingent fee arrangement, unless the 
contingent fee arrangement is approved by the emergency commission. A state governmental 
entity may not contract for legal services that are compensated by a contingent fee 
arrangement, unless the entity receives an appointment from the attorney general for a special 
assistant attorney general for each case in which there is a contingent fee arrangement. Any 
proceeding or information used by the emergency commission under this section is not subject 
to sections 44-04-18 and 44-04-19, unless made public by order of the emergency commission.
